Only two (or occasionally three) eclipse seasons occur each year, and each season lasts about 35 days and repeats just short of six months (173 days) later; thus two full eclipse seasons always occur each year. 315:, where a number of universities and institutes of higher education were evacuated during the war, on June 30, 1941, and arrived in Lintao on August 13. They traveled by car for a total of 3,200 kilometres and made science popularization speeches along the way.
493:. The weather was good in Almaty with many observation results, while there were some clouds in Kyzylorda but several image were still taken. European and American astronomers did not went to the Soviet Union due to the war.
